有两个常人所不熟悉的,但使用率非常高的Linux与Unix命令是什么?它们能做什么?
Brad Casey:在我的系统管理员职业生涯中,我发现有些命令使用率少得可怜。例如,chmod、ls、mkdir等就是Linux管理员在日常任务中绝少使用的典型命令。关于“少为人知,用处极大”的命令,我要说它们对于每个管理员来说都是特别的存在。出现在我脑海是这些:
watch -n1 –difference “echo “Uptime”; uptime; echo n ; ps -eo pcpu,pid,args | sort -k 1 -r |grep -v watch | head -10; echo “n” ; tail /var/log/cron| grep check_load”
上面的命令允许系统管理员在命令行中引导本地系统的实时监控。输出类似于Windows管理员在Task Manager所看到的。该命令的焦点围绕一个应用所消耗的CPU百分比、该应用的进程ID以及唤醒应用所使用的命令。
history|awk ‘{print $2}’ |awk ‘{print $1}’ | sort | uniq -c | sort -rn | head -10
上面的命令可让系统管理员查看当时机器上的最常用命令。有类似的命令让管理员查看整个网络上最常用的命令,但我推荐使用该命令,因为它能让管理员登陆分配给自己的盒子,并查看里面所能使用的命令。一旦发现异常,管理员能推断有其他人从他的计算机执行命令。
我们一直都在努力坚持原创.......请不要一声不吭,就悄悄拿走。
我原创,你原创,我们的内容世界才会更加精彩!
【所有原创内容版权均属TechTarget,欢迎大家转发分享。但未经授权,严禁任何媒体(平面媒体、网络媒体、自媒体等)以及微信公众号复制、转载、摘编或以其他方式进行使用。】
微信公众号
TechTarget
官方微博
TechTarget中国
翻译
相关推荐
-
托管OpenStack私有云能够获得支持or单打独斗?
OpenStack私有云托管作为一种服务可以简化企业的部署和运营,并强调了云计算的优势,而非Linux的优化……
-
最值得考虑的两大Linux备份工具:Amanda和Bacula
本文介绍最值得考虑的Linux备份工具:Amanda和Bacula。Amanda是市场上最早开放源码的Linux备份工具之一。Bacula是一套免费的备份程序,允许管理员管理跨异构网络的备份、恢复和数据验证。
-
Linux网络连接有问题?Ping工具来帮忙
如果网络发生了故障,那么所有其他的(服务)都会出现故障。管理员可以使用Ping工具来帮助自己让掉线的Linux服务器重新上线。
-
Windows管理员需要知道的Linux技巧
随着科技界的模式持续改变,Windows管理员还将继续接触和接受越来越多的Linux服务器。本文将帮助Windows管理员们快速熟悉Linux相关知识。